"The Folk of Furry Farm: The Romance of an Irish Village" by Katherine Frances Purdon offers a charming glimpse into the heart of rural Ireland. This classic work of fiction paints a vivid picture of village life, capturing the enduring spirit and close-knit community of a bygone era.
Set against the backdrop of the Irish countryside, this general fiction novel explores the themes of romance and everyday life. Purdon’s prose evokes a sense of place, transporting readers to Furry Farm and immersing them in the rhythms and relationships that define this unique locale.
